【Bug Report】el-input-number 键盘事件未被监听 技术标签:Delete Bug Steps to reproduce(重现步骤) 使用el-input-number组件的时候,使用键盘随便打几个数字,发现校验系统检测不到数据,会报错, What is Expected?(希望得到的效果) 键盘输入的时候,也可以检测到(而不只是加减的时候) 找了很久都没有找到解决方法...
el-input-number是Element UI库中的一个组件,用于创建数字输入框。要触发el-input-number组件的增减方法,可以使用@change事件。 下面是一个示例代码,展示了如何使用@change事件来触发el-input-number组件的增减方法: html <template> <el-input-number v-model="number" @change="handleChange"></el-input-number...
分析说明 el-input-number是element的一个组件,并非简单的标签,而change事件监听的是整个组件。 也就是说,光标移开触发change事件,此时cycle值为12.3,马上触发dom更新。 此时修改了cycle的值,祛除了小数位。(当前组件已经被监测到变化,已经触发了重新渲染dom,此时再修改并不会再次渲染dom。) 导致dom更新在前,cycle的...
使用vue-element 的计数器inputNumber。 其中的change 事件中,默认自带两个参数,currentValue和oldValue,分别代表改变后的数和改变前的数, 如果想要传第三个参数, @change="(currentValue, oldVal
Vue 中 .native 修饰符的作用是:在一个组件的根元素上直接监听一个原生事件。 而el-input-number 的根元素并非 input,而是一个 div,那为什么使用 input.native 能起效呢? 其实,是 “事件捕获” 在起作用。也就是说在 input 框中修改数据时,它所有的父节点都会捕获 input 事件。因此,我们也就能在根元素 div...
el-input-number这个组件,同时响应⿏标单击操作和⿏标放置不放的操作。针对⿏标点击操作,点击⼀下“ +”号,数字增加⼀个步长。针对对准不放操作,每100ms,数字增加⼀个步长。针对不同笔记本的触摸板,对于轻触触摸板的处理是不同的,有的品牌模拟成⼀次点击事件,有的品牌模拟成⼀次长按事件。
el-input-number是一个 Vue.js 的组件,用于处理数字输入。然而,它并不直接支持科学计数法。如果你希望用户能够使用科学计数法输入数字,你可以考虑以下两种方法: 1.在前端进行处理:你可以在用户输入后使用 JavaScript 进行科学计数法的转换。例如,你可以监听el-input-number的change事件,然后在这个事件的处理函数中进行...
Steps to reproduce(重现步骤)使用el-input-number组件的时候,使用键盘随便打几个数字,发现校验系统检测不到数据,会报错, What is Expected?(希望得到的效果) 键盘输入的时候,也可以检测到(而不只是加减的时候) 找了很久都没有找到解决方法然后看到了这个链接el-input-numberinput事件没有被监听 里面大佬的回答:如果...
除了以上的属性,还可以通过监听`change`事件来自定义规则。例如: html <el-input-number v-model="number" @change="handleChange"></el-input-number> javascript methods: { handleChange(value) { 自定义规则处理逻辑 } } 上述代码中,`number`是绑定的数据,`@change`监听了`change`事件,并调用了`handleCha...